Top 8 Home Designs And Building Trends That Will Define 2022

Top 8 Home Designs And Building Trends That Will Define 2022

Home Designs And Building Trends

Home design and building trends are becoming more personal. According to some online home design experts, the individuality of homeowners is being shown off more and more through their homes.

A lot of time has been spent at home in the last couple of years – both working and living. That has equated to homeowners wanting an environment that expresses their individual tastes and personalities. They want to be somewhere conducive to enjoyment – whether they’re working there or not. Since traveling wasn’t an option recently, people are expressing the desire for their homes to contain the same experiences they might have enjoyed while traveling.

All of this said, here are some of the building trends and home designs that we may see during the rest of 2022.

Luxurious Outdoors

Expect to see indoor living expanded to the out-of-doors. Porches, patios, and decks are becoming an extension of today’s homeowners’ interiors. It’s not uncommon to see high-end pools coupled with fireplaces, televisions, and other various outdoor living room settings.

Metal Roofs

Decidedly eco-friendly, metal roofs are also long-lasting. What’s more, they’ve become extremely stylish. Accent a roof over windows, over a porch, or use it on the entire home. Between 40 and 70 years is not an uncommon life expectancy for today’s metal roofs.

Building Elements Are Curvier

The straight-line syndrome is out. Expect to see more curvy furniture, barrel-vaulted ceilings, and arched room openings. To reflect curved walkways, decks, or porches, you might spot more arched doors and windows.

Maximalism

Kitschy and high-quality antiques are going to be more and more in demand. This idea will be accented through items that incorporate creative expressions of an owner’s personality. Paint, art, rugs, furnishings, and more will be instrumental. Experiences involving future dream locations and past travel destinations may also be integrated.

Biophilic Design

Homeowners are bringing the outside inside. Maximizing plants, fresh air, sunlight, and other natural elements, involved in both the interior and exterior of homes in 2022, more organic materials and larger windows will be used.

Black Accents

Growing in popularity will be either matte or shiny black appliances, black lacquered entry doors, black window frames, etc. – both indoors and outdoors.

More Color in the Kitchen

All white counters and kitchen cabinets are on the way out. Add some spice with vibrant color, in addition to using the various herbs in your cabinet. More and more cabinet doors and wood cabinets will be painted and countertops changed out. Expect to see more decor involving mixed materials.

Hardwood Patterns

Designers say, growing more popular by the day, are patterns, two-tone inlays, completely different tones, and other various forms of old-world craftsmanship. Expect to see lighter hardwood flooring in just part of a room or throughout an entire space.
